Transaction 774771e095be52ed7115238f64bd7d834c6ced04a5dfc4c7984c53016a01da59

1 Input
2 Outputs
  • 774771e095be52ed7115238f64bd7d834c6ced04a5dfc4c7984c53016a01da59:0
  • value  300000000
    address  3H1KbfLaScXpwR2gNnwSNMvw9KdhuHQWs7
  • 774771e095be52ed7115238f64bd7d834c6ced04a5dfc4c7984c53016a01da59:1
  • value  3499990144
    address  1PbZuGVGaqfYGeJoaqZHciZ5si15dQYbeN